Output 66e82e3876835d1dfdae7c41117655b74fd9a50cade9331282f2f4d4f9ed4d4f:2

value
3165182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b3a5eade134f3c3bc22def1d66e1ddac9866e4 OP_EQUAL
address
3Htcjfg487ep5vw3GFW3DXTripyAo5qUMm
transaction
66e82e3876835d1dfdae7c41117655b74fd9a50cade9331282f2f4d4f9ed4d4f
spent
true